Transaction e3ba6a96cf7bcec43cf59e2123ef7e7f9c734fb6ca26594a1eb608d6f6a0545a
2 Input
1 Outputs
- e3ba6a96cf7bcec43cf59e2123ef7e7f9c734fb6ca26594a1eb608d6f6a0545a:0
value 2174306
address 1738uWTSrwt9XJNF1JBnNmvDmDTe6u5fq3